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ons Olive Oil
  • 2 tablespoons Butter
  • 2 cups slice Onion
  • 1 cup Chicken Broth/Stock
  • ½ cups White Cooking Wine
  • 10 ounces Cream of Mushroom Soup
  • ½ cups Milk
  • ½ teaspoons Black Pepper
  • ½ teaspoons Salt
  • 16 ounces Penne
  • 1 ½ cups Mozzarella Cheese, Shredded
  • 2 ⅔ cups cook and dice Chicken, Boneless Breasts

Make It Now Cooking Directions

Stove Cook

These directions are for cooking this recipe to serve immediately and NOT to freeze for later.

  1. In a large pan, heat olive oil and butter over medium heat.
  2. Stir in onions and cook for 4-5 minutes, until onions begin to soften.
  3. Pour in chicken broth, white wine, soup, milk, pepper and salt. Stir well, then reduce heat to low.
  4. Cook for 20 minutes, until sauce begins to thicken, stirring frequently.
  5. While sauce is cooking, prepare penne noodles according to the package directions until just al dente.
  6. Stir cheese and chicken into sauce, then remove from heat.
  7. Drain pasta, then stir in sauce and chicken.

  2. What would you recommend as a substitute for white wine? My husband has a severe alcohol allergy and I don’t want to take any chances. Thanks!

    1. Hi Christina! You could use chicken broth in place of it. I don’t think cooking wine has any alcohol in it either but chicken broth would probably keep you the safest.
